What the PDF looks like: CSS, images, links and page breaks

The conversion runs in the same engine that powers the Chrome browser. The page is loaded fully, scripts run, fonts arrive, and only then is the PDF made.

HTML to PDF with CSS, without losing formatting

Modern layouts built with flexbox, grid, web fonts and custom colours render the way they do in Chrome. So you get HTML to PDF with CSS applied, not a bare wall of text. One thing to know: many sites ship a separate print style that hides menus, sidebars and comment boxes when a page is printed. We respect it, so the PDF can look cleaner than the screen version. That is the site's choice, and it usually helps you convert HTML to PDF without losing formatting that matters, such as headings, tables and spacing.

HTML to PDF with images and with links

Pictures that load with the page are included, so HTML to PDF with images works for normal articles, product pages and certificates. Images that only appear when you scroll far down may be missing, because nobody scrolls during the capture. Links normally stay clickable in the result, so an HTML to PDF with links still lets you tap through to the sources. Videos and animations show up as a still frame or an empty box.

Can I get HTML to PDF without page breaks?

Not as one endless page. The PDF is cut into A4 or US Letter sheets so that it prints properly, and one long scrolling sheet is not supported. Where the page breaks fall is partly in your hands, though. Landscape gives wide tables more room, and if the HTML is yours, the CSS rule break-inside: avoid keeps a table row or a card together on one sheet. If you need to print a webpage to PDF without page breaks at all, use your browser's own Print dialog with a custom paper height; that is a browser feature, not one we offer.

High quality output, not a screenshot

The engine prints the page rather than photographing it, so the result is a high quality HTML to PDF conversion: text stays real text that you can select and search, fonts stay crisp at any zoom, and photos are stored at the size the site served them. A screenshot tool would give you one blurry picture per page; this gives you a proper document.

When your browser's Print option is the better choice

Every desktop browser can print a page and save it as a PDF. For pages behind a login, such as net banking, a college portal or your email, use that, because your browser is already signed in and our server is not. Your own browser can also print a saved page with no connection at all.

Converting an .html file instead of a link

Under the link box there is a second option, Select HTML file. Upload an .html or .htm file and it goes through the same engine. This is handy for exported reports, email templates and invoices made by a script. HTML is a format meant for screens of any width. The HTML to PDF format change fixes it onto pages of a set size, so it looks the same for everyone who opens it.

One caution: a single uploaded file can only pull in styles and pictures that sit at a full web address. A stylesheet or photo that exists only in a folder on your computer can't be reached. Put the CSS inside the HTML file itself and the HTML to PDF tool will pick it up.

Pages that can't be converted, and what to try

A webpage to PDF conversion from a link has limits, and it is better to know them than to stare at an error.

  • Pages behind a login or paywall: our server sees only the sign-in screen.
  • Sites that block bots: some shopping, ticketing and social sites refuse automated visitors. Use Print in your browser for these too.
  • Content that loads on scroll: endless feeds and lazy galleries are captured only as far as they load by themselves.
  • Cookie banners and pop-ups: they may be printed on top of the text. A Print or Reader version of the page avoids them.
  • Links to your own computer or office network, such as localhost, can't be reached from outside. Upload the .html file instead.

Does HTML to PDF work offline?

Not here. Our server has to fetch the page, so you need to be online. For HTML to PDF offline, open the saved .html file in your desktop browser, choose Print and pick Save as PDF as the printer. That uses only your own computer.

Why does the PDF look different from the page on my screen?

A PDF page is narrower than a wide monitor, so columns may stack, and the site's print style may hide menus and sidebars. Try Landscape for a wider page. If big parts are missing, the content probably needs a login or loads only when you scroll.

Should I pick A4 or US Letter?

Pick the paper your printer uses. A4 is the standard in India, Europe and most of the world. US Letter is a little shorter and wider, and is used in the United States and Canada. If you only plan to read the PDF on a screen, either one works. Tick Landscape when the page has wide tables.
